dev-coverage 0.9.1

Code coverage with regression gates for Rust. Wraps cargo-llvm-cov: line / function / region kill rates, stored baselines, machine-readable verdicts. Part of the dev-* verification collection.

/// Real subprocess test. Only runs when `cargo-llvm-cov` is installed.
///
/// **Important:** when running this test from a `cargo test` invocation
/// inside this same crate, set `CARGO_TARGET_DIR` to a path *outside*
/// the workspace. Otherwise the outer `cargo test` holds the lock on
/// `target/` and the inner `cargo llvm-cov` blocks waiting for it
/// indefinitely (cargo's well-known target-dir lock).
///
/// ```text
/// CARGO_TARGET_DIR=/tmp/llvm-cov-target cargo test -- --ignored
/// ```
///
/// CI runs this test? No. The deadlock makes it impractical there; the
/// JSON parser is covered by the fixtures in `src/lib.rs`. This test is
/// here as a local smoke check for contributors who want to verify the
/// end-to-end pipeline against their own `cargo-llvm-cov` install.
#[test]
#[ignore = "requires cargo-llvm-cov + CARGO_TARGET_DIR outside the workspace"]
fn execute_against_real_llvm_cov() {
    let run = CoverageRun::new("dev-coverage", "0.9.0");
    let r = run.execute().expect("cargo-llvm-cov is installed");
    assert!(r.line_pct >= 0.0);
    assert!(r.line_pct <= 100.0);
}
